As with robot vacuums, the majority of robotic mops are connected to your Wi-Fi network and include an app that allows you to save maps of your home, set cleaning schedules, customize mopping modes, and track what your device is doing while it's working. Find models that have smart home integration so that you can use it with voice assistants such as Alexa or Google Assistant. You'll want to decide if you'd like a robot which can do dry sweeping and mopping with wet water or simply vacuums. Certain mops require pads to be manually wet before use and will require cleaning after every use (as well as emptying of dirty water, if necessary).

You should also consider how long the robot can run on one battery charge and the size of its water tank and if it's able to adjust the amount it employs for mopping wet. It is important to choose a robot mop which can navigate between carpets and hardwood floors in the event that you live that has both. It's also beneficial if your robot can identify and avoid furniture legs or area rugs, as well as smaller items that may randomly be lying on the floor.
Most robot mops come with some kind of self-cleaning feature that cleans the docking station and base. Also, you should look for a model equipped with a touchscreen or a remote control that is simple to use so that you can easily adjust settings. Download any software updates your model offers through its app. These can improve the ability to navigate and recognize objects.

Check the instruction manual for your robot mop prior to using any cleaning solution. Some manufacturers only recommend certain brands of cleaners. Using any other liquid can damage the warranty or even void it.
The most effective robot mops have rotating heads that lift food and other debris that has accumulated on the floor. These mops have cleaning modes that scrub the floor with more scrubbing, which helps remove stubborn stains. The SpinWave, for instance, lifted a dried mud stain only two passes through its cleaning cycle which was quicker than most other mops we tried.
Some models come with an unclean and dirty water tank that automatically drains and washes the mop pads after each cleaning. This feature saves time and effort by removing the need to wash and empty the pads manually. It is also important to consider the size of the water tank and whether you're able make use of different cleaning solutions for each task. If you're using a model that utilizes disposable or reusable mopping pads, make sure they can be easily cleaned after every use. Mopping robots can trap lots of moisture beneath the device. If the cloths or pads remain wet for prolonged periods of time, they could develop mildew and bacteria.
